Question 192042: the side of a cube is increasing at a constant rate of .2 centimeters per second. in terms of the surface area s what is the rate of change of the volume of the cube in cubic centimeters per second?
a) .1
b).2
c).6
d).04
e).008

If each edge is a:
surface area = 6a^2
Volume = a^3
The rate of change of the volume = 3a^2
That's 1/2 of the surface area.
--------------------
A number is given for the rate of change, 0.2 cm/sec, but no value for the length of the side, so a numerical answer is not possible.
The answer doesn't match any of the choices. I suspect something is wrong.
